WebOct 26, 2024 · No matter how often you shower, there are things you can do to keep your skin as healthy as possible. Use warm water. Hot water can strip the skin of protective oils, like sebum. Keep it short. Five to 10 minutes is ideal. Use a non-drying soap. Whether you prefer a bar or liquid body cleanser, choose one labeled as moisturizing. This is where a sponge … WebFeb 14, 2011 · A shower is inviting after a hard workout, but you should never rush straight under the spray. Take at least 10 or 15 minutes to cool down. You should not be sweating heavily or breathing hard when you hit the showers. Otherwise, you'll still be sweating when you finish and likely to become chilled if you go out into the cold. christopher and banks bankruptcy

WebJan 17, 2024 · Simply go to the front desk at the truck stop and purchase a ticket with a number on it that shows you your place in line. Then, you’ll simply wait until you see your number appear on a screen by the shower rooms. Once you see your number, you will also see a specific shower room assigned to you.
